Output 81b46077bb79e6319ab55cf6177d7220fd0d41f31812b3493c7717c639f55d40:0

value
1270252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59db33e420d9ee9e417c79751b5853af04252ffa OP_EQUAL
address
39t8f61kFQjunfpWac2eqoHU4WkKAmNYA8
transaction
81b46077bb79e6319ab55cf6177d7220fd0d41f31812b3493c7717c639f55d40
confirmations
333059
spent
true